DocumentCode
3065578
Title
ARV-based Array Grouping and Data Distribution in OpenMP/JIAJIA
Author
Lifang, Zeng ; Xuejun, Yang ; Huangchun
Author_Institution
National Laboratory for Parallel and Distributed Processing, China
fYear
2005
fDate
05-08 Dec. 2005
Firstpage
900
Lastpage
903
Abstract
In order to improve the performance of applications on OpenMP/JIAJIA, we present a new abstraction, Array Relation Vector (ARV), to describe the relation between the data elements of two consistent shared arrays accessed in one computation phase. Based on ARV, we use array grouping to eliminate the pseudo data distributing of small shared data and improve the page locality. Experimental results show that ARV-based array grouping can greatly improve the performance of applications with non-continuous data access and strict access affinity on OpenMP/JIAJIA cluster. For applications with small shared arrays, array grouping can improve the performance obviously when the processor number is small.
Keywords
Application software; Concurrent computing; Distributed computing; Distributed processing; Emulation; Laboratories; Parallel architectures; Parallel programming; Phased arrays; Programming profession;
fLanguage
English
Publisher
ieee
Conference_Titel
Parallel and Distributed Computing, Applications and Technologies, 2005. PDCAT 2005. Sixth International Conference on
Print_ISBN
0-7695-2405-2
Type
conf
DOI
10.1109/PDCAT.2005.92
Filename
1579058
Link To Document